Transaction 823625ea6ba700071fec0cbedfb88d3707a7f8abdae5768bd2a74a041b023b02
1 Input
1 Output
-
823625ea6ba700071fec0cbedfb88d3707a7f8abdae5768bd2a74a041b023b02:0
- value
- 640467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cd3a695f7937c130415bdfa7ad5f86b65b8262c OP_EQUAL
- address
- 38hEpsbNq54uGLRAwhitKwhU4Z4Hw83DTn